Song Thrush Song Evokes Family Memories

The song thrush, a bird known for its clear and deliberate vocalizations, is currently the only species singing in the author's garden during early summer mornings. This particular bird has maintained its song since the beginning of the year, its repeated phrases being instantly recognisable.

Childhood Echoes

The sound of the song thrush consistently brings to mind earlier times. The author recalls that in their childhood, the arrival of spring was heralded by thrushes singing from rooftops on suburban streets during late winter afternoons.

A Great-Grandfather's Tale

Further back in memory, the author remembers stories shared by their grandmother about her father, Edgar Snow. Before the First World War, during summer evenings as he travelled home from his work, Mr Snow would hear a bird's song. This bird appeared to be communicating directly with him, with calls that sounded like 'Snowy, Snowy – pay the rent, pay the rent'.

It was many years later, after the grandmother had passed away, that the author identified the bird responsible for these sounds. The song thrush's vocalizations are described as speaking directly and insistently.

Now, over a century after Edgar Snow heard the bird, the author feels a distinct link to their great-grandfather whenever a song thrush sings. The clear sound heard each morning serves as a connection to a relative they never had the chance to know, as reported by The Guardian.
